SlideShare a Scribd company logo
Presented By: Rahul Soni
benefits & features, flexible,
extensibility etc.
Lack of etiquette and manners is a huge turn off.
KnolX Etiquettes
Punctuality
Respect Knolx session timings, you
are requested not to join sessions
after a 5 minutes threshold post
the session start time.
Feedback
Make sure to submit a constructive
feedback for all sessions as it is
very helpful for the presenter.
Silent Mode
Keep your mobile devices in silent
mode, feel free to move out of
session in case you need to attend
an urgent call.
Avoid Disturbance
Avoid unwanted chit chat during
the session.
Our Agenda
01 Gitlab Introduction
02 When & where to use ?
03 In-house features
04 Some Alternatives
05 Demo
Gitlab Introduction
● GitLab is a web-based Git repository that provides free open and
private repositories, issue-following capabilities, and wikis.
● A complete DevOps tool that comes with all CI/CD feature including
alerts, security scanning & testing (SAST, DAST), vulnerability reports,
infrastructure management, artifacts registry.
● Used for automated builds, deployments, monitoring & to create
flexible but automated pipelines.
What is Gitlab ?
● CICD is Continuous integration (CI) and continuous delivery
(CD).
● It’s method to introduce automation in the stages of
application development to enhance quality of application
and to frequently deliver applications to clients.
What is CI/CD ?
When & where to use ?
● To ship the application quickly and efficiently & when you want to automate the
stages of development cycle.
● Continuous feedbacks is great way to monitor & improve your application. In Gitlab,
we can implement monitoring & analytics.
● Where you do not want any human involvement in any of build stages in terms of
security.
● To keep your builds & jobs safe & secure
When & where to use Gitlab ?
In-house features of Gitlab
● Web-based source code management & version control system.
● Integrated jira support for project management.
● CICD pipeline with editor, linting & visualization of pipeline.
● So many keywords for complex & flexible jobs.
● Visualization for MRs with code coverage & testing
● Security & compliance
● Managed Deployment
● Monitoring & analytics
● Infrastructure management
● Artifacts Registry
● Code snippets
● Wiki for documentation
Features of Gitlab
Some Alternatives
Demo
Thank You !
Please leave a constructive feedback

More Related Content

PPTX
Introduction to GItlab CICD Presentation.pptx
PPTX
GitLab for CI/CD process
PPTX
Lyra Infosystems - GitLab Overview Deck 2020
PPTX
Git Lab Introduction
PDF
Api gitlab: configurazione dei progetti as a service
PDF
What's New in GitLab and Software Development Trends
PDF
Gitlab for JS developers (BrisJs meetup, 2019-Apr-01)
PDF
Overview of Gitlab usage
Introduction to GItlab CICD Presentation.pptx
GitLab for CI/CD process
Lyra Infosystems - GitLab Overview Deck 2020
Git Lab Introduction
Api gitlab: configurazione dei progetti as a service
What's New in GitLab and Software Development Trends
Gitlab for JS developers (BrisJs meetup, 2019-Apr-01)
Overview of Gitlab usage

Similar to KnolX _ Gitlab - Rahul_Soni (20)

PDF
Continuous Integration/Deployment with Gitlab CI
PDF
Gitlab ci, cncf.sk
PDF
Gitlab for PHP developers (Brisbane PHP meetup, 2019-Jan-29)
PDF
Introducing GitLab (June 2018)
PDF
Gitlab ci-cd
PDF
GitLab: One Tool for Software Development (2018-02-06 @ SEIUM, Braga, Portugal)
PDF
Introducing GitLab (September 2018)
PPTX
Axway's Journey to the Cloud
PDF
Introduction To Development And Operations
PDF
Git tech
PDF
Simplifying complexity at GitLab (2023-07-31 @ OutSystems Product Design Unwr...
PDF
GitHub Vs GitLab | What Are The Major Difference?
PDF
Introducing GitLab (September 2018)
PPTX
Devops.pptx
PDF
#ATAGTR2019 Presentation "DevSecOps with GitLab" By Avishkar Nikale
PDF
Webinar - Unbox GitLab CI/CD
PPTX
GitLab.pptx
PPTX
Gitlab CI/CD
PPTX
Difference between Github vs Gitlab vs Bitbucket
PPTX
Meetup gitlab intro in seoul
Continuous Integration/Deployment with Gitlab CI
Gitlab ci, cncf.sk
Gitlab for PHP developers (Brisbane PHP meetup, 2019-Jan-29)
Introducing GitLab (June 2018)
Gitlab ci-cd
GitLab: One Tool for Software Development (2018-02-06 @ SEIUM, Braga, Portugal)
Introducing GitLab (September 2018)
Axway's Journey to the Cloud
Introduction To Development And Operations
Git tech
Simplifying complexity at GitLab (2023-07-31 @ OutSystems Product Design Unwr...
GitHub Vs GitLab | What Are The Major Difference?
Introducing GitLab (September 2018)
Devops.pptx
#ATAGTR2019 Presentation "DevSecOps with GitLab" By Avishkar Nikale
Webinar - Unbox GitLab CI/CD
GitLab.pptx
Gitlab CI/CD
Difference between Github vs Gitlab vs Bitbucket
Meetup gitlab intro in seoul
Ad

More from Knoldus Inc. (20)

PPTX
Angular Hydration Presentation (FrontEnd)
PPTX
Optimizing Test Execution: Heuristic Algorithm for Self-Healing
PPTX
Self-Healing Test Automation Framework - Healenium
PPTX
Kanban Metrics Presentation (Project Management)
PPTX
Java 17 features and implementation.pptx
PPTX
Chaos Mesh Introducing Chaos in Kubernetes
PPTX
GraalVM - A Step Ahead of JVM Presentation
PPTX
Nomad by HashiCorp Presentation (DevOps)
PPTX
Nomad by HashiCorp Presentation (DevOps)
PPTX
DAPR - Distributed Application Runtime Presentation
PPTX
Introduction to Azure Virtual WAN Presentation
PPTX
Introduction to Argo Rollouts Presentation
PPTX
Intro to Azure Container App Presentation
PPTX
Insights Unveiled Test Reporting and Observability Excellence
PPTX
Introduction to Splunk Presentation (DevOps)
PPTX
Code Camp - Data Profiling and Quality Analysis Framework
PPTX
AWS: Messaging Services in AWS Presentation
PPTX
Amazon Cognito: A Primer on Authentication and Authorization
PPTX
ZIO Http A Functional Approach to Scalable and Type-Safe Web Development
PPTX
Managing State & HTTP Requests In Ionic.
Angular Hydration Presentation (FrontEnd)
Optimizing Test Execution: Heuristic Algorithm for Self-Healing
Self-Healing Test Automation Framework - Healenium
Kanban Metrics Presentation (Project Management)
Java 17 features and implementation.pptx
Chaos Mesh Introducing Chaos in Kubernetes
GraalVM - A Step Ahead of JVM Presentation
Nomad by HashiCorp Presentation (DevOps)
Nomad by HashiCorp Presentation (DevOps)
DAPR - Distributed Application Runtime Presentation
Introduction to Azure Virtual WAN Presentation
Introduction to Argo Rollouts Presentation
Intro to Azure Container App Presentation
Insights Unveiled Test Reporting and Observability Excellence
Introduction to Splunk Presentation (DevOps)
Code Camp - Data Profiling and Quality Analysis Framework
AWS: Messaging Services in AWS Presentation
Amazon Cognito: A Primer on Authentication and Authorization
ZIO Http A Functional Approach to Scalable and Type-Safe Web Development
Managing State & HTTP Requests In Ionic.
Ad

Recently uploaded (20)

PDF
Bridging biosciences and deep learning for revolutionary discoveries: a compr...
PDF
Electronic commerce courselecture one. Pdf
PPTX
Understanding_Digital_Forensics_Presentation.pptx
PPT
Teaching material agriculture food technology
PDF
Unlocking AI with Model Context Protocol (MCP)
PDF
NewMind AI Weekly Chronicles - August'25 Week I
PDF
Spectral efficient network and resource selection model in 5G networks
PDF
Machine learning based COVID-19 study performance prediction
PDF
Advanced methodologies resolving dimensionality complications for autism neur...
PDF
The Rise and Fall of 3GPP – Time for a Sabbatical?
PDF
Encapsulation theory and applications.pdf
PDF
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
PDF
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
PDF
NewMind AI Monthly Chronicles - July 2025
PPTX
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
PDF
Review of recent advances in non-invasive hemoglobin estimation
PDF
CIFDAQ's Market Insight: SEC Turns Pro Crypto
PDF
Per capita expenditure prediction using model stacking based on satellite ima...
PDF
Encapsulation_ Review paper, used for researhc scholars
DOCX
The AUB Centre for AI in Media Proposal.docx
Bridging biosciences and deep learning for revolutionary discoveries: a compr...
Electronic commerce courselecture one. Pdf
Understanding_Digital_Forensics_Presentation.pptx
Teaching material agriculture food technology
Unlocking AI with Model Context Protocol (MCP)
NewMind AI Weekly Chronicles - August'25 Week I
Spectral efficient network and resource selection model in 5G networks
Machine learning based COVID-19 study performance prediction
Advanced methodologies resolving dimensionality complications for autism neur...
The Rise and Fall of 3GPP – Time for a Sabbatical?
Encapsulation theory and applications.pdf
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
NewMind AI Monthly Chronicles - July 2025
KOM of Painting work and Equipment Insulation REV00 update 25-dec.pptx
Review of recent advances in non-invasive hemoglobin estimation
CIFDAQ's Market Insight: SEC Turns Pro Crypto
Per capita expenditure prediction using model stacking based on satellite ima...
Encapsulation_ Review paper, used for researhc scholars
The AUB Centre for AI in Media Proposal.docx

KnolX _ Gitlab - Rahul_Soni

  • 1. Presented By: Rahul Soni benefits & features, flexible, extensibility etc.
  • 2. Lack of etiquette and manners is a huge turn off. KnolX Etiquettes Punctuality Respect Knolx session timings, you are requested not to join sessions after a 5 minutes threshold post the session start time. Feedback Make sure to submit a constructive feedback for all sessions as it is very helpful for the presenter. Silent Mode Keep your mobile devices in silent mode, feel free to move out of session in case you need to attend an urgent call. Avoid Disturbance Avoid unwanted chit chat during the session.
  • 3. Our Agenda 01 Gitlab Introduction 02 When & where to use ? 03 In-house features 04 Some Alternatives 05 Demo
  • 4. Gitlab Introduction ● GitLab is a web-based Git repository that provides free open and private repositories, issue-following capabilities, and wikis. ● A complete DevOps tool that comes with all CI/CD feature including alerts, security scanning & testing (SAST, DAST), vulnerability reports, infrastructure management, artifacts registry. ● Used for automated builds, deployments, monitoring & to create flexible but automated pipelines. What is Gitlab ? ● CICD is Continuous integration (CI) and continuous delivery (CD). ● It’s method to introduce automation in the stages of application development to enhance quality of application and to frequently deliver applications to clients. What is CI/CD ?
  • 5. When & where to use ? ● To ship the application quickly and efficiently & when you want to automate the stages of development cycle. ● Continuous feedbacks is great way to monitor & improve your application. In Gitlab, we can implement monitoring & analytics. ● Where you do not want any human involvement in any of build stages in terms of security. ● To keep your builds & jobs safe & secure When & where to use Gitlab ?
  • 6. In-house features of Gitlab ● Web-based source code management & version control system. ● Integrated jira support for project management. ● CICD pipeline with editor, linting & visualization of pipeline. ● So many keywords for complex & flexible jobs. ● Visualization for MRs with code coverage & testing ● Security & compliance ● Managed Deployment ● Monitoring & analytics ● Infrastructure management ● Artifacts Registry ● Code snippets ● Wiki for documentation Features of Gitlab
  • 9. Thank You ! Please leave a constructive feedback